Dev Accelerator (DevX) has signed what it calls India's single largest managed office deal under its Development Management (DM) model — a 27-storey, 8 lakh sq ft Grade A+ commercial tower in Ahmedabad's Ambli-Bopal micro-market. The total rental value of the deal exceeds ₹850 crore, with projected annual revenue of ₹120 crore once operational. The project will add 8,500 seats, involves an investment of ₹100 crore spread over four years, and is expected to be ready in 2.5–3 years. The agreement runs for 15 years, with DevX locked in for four years. This follows the company's earlier 3.15 lakh sq ft Ahmedabad campus (3,200 seats, ₹36 crore revenue, 95% occupancy), and reinforces its Tier-2 city strategy targeting GCCs (Global Capability Centres).
This is a major positive for shareholders — the deal alone is projected to add ₹120 crore in annual revenue, which is more than 3x the revenue currently generated by DevX's existing 3.15 lakh sq ft Ahmedabad asset. It significantly expands the company's footprint and could materially boost future earnings, though benefits will accrue over the next 2.5–3 years as the project gets built out.
